My main Gilmour Guitars I use.
galleryThe Black Strat is a replica I made with fender parts and the pickups are Fender CS Fat 50s Neck, Fender CS ‘69 middle, and Seymour Duncan DG SSL-1c.
The Epiphone is a 1956 Gold Top Reissue with a bigsby installed.

Breathe ( in the air) lap steel intro
My attempt on the ethereal lap steel intro in Breathe. Iconic intro on a quite unusual instrument! I recorded the main riff with my black strat and then did 3 overdubs on the lap steel guitar to get those little nuances you hear in the original recording. I hope you enjoy it! Gear: 1958 fender lap steel, fender Stratocaster, Helix LT, GarageBand.
